"In 2002 I invited Melanie James to fill the role of Information Director at the Australian Electoral Commission for a three month period while permanent staffing arrangements were finalised. Ms James was responsible for the full range of public relations activities associated with the 2001 federal election including the finalisation of an extensive publishing program, performance review of the national telephone enquiry service and the updating of the AEC's website. Ms James also dealt with a variety of media issues and provided advice to the Electoral Commissioner and other senior staff on matters affecting the AEC's reputation. She provided insight, energy and sound advice in this important role and in a short period of time she made a valuable contribution." Brien Hallett Assistant Commissioner - Public Awareness, Media and Research, Australian Electoral Commission.

"We worked harmoniously together with Melanie for some months in a major national media campaign in 2001 in her role as Director of Public Relations at the Australian Bureau of Statistics. This was a most successful and well managed campaign to educate 20 million Australians about a major change in federal government policy - to save the 2001 Australian census in the National Archives for the first time in 200 years. This campaign involved a series of television, press and radio messages. She was impressively organised." - Nick VINE HALL - Chairman, Census Working Party, 1996-2005 & Media Spokesman, Record Preservation & Access, Australasian Federation of Family History Organizations.
